Record Hours of Service with the TMT ELD

STEP 3:
STEP 1:
When your vehicle is moving at 5 MPH or greater, TMT ELD
considers the vehicle to be IN MOTION and your duty status will
automatically be set to Driving.

When STATIONARY, you can change your duty status by tapping
DRIVING and selecting one of the alternate duty statuses listed.

STEP 4:
STEP 2:
At 0 MPH, the vehicle is considered STATIONARY.

If the vehicle remains STATIONARY for ve minutes, a pop-up
window will appear that asks if you still driving or not. If nothing
is selected, your duty status will automatically be changed to On
Duty.

ELD Malfunction

 395.22 Motor carrier responsibilitiesIn general. (h) In-vehicle
information. A motor carrier must ensure that its drivers possess
onboard a commercial motor vehicle an ELD information packet
containing the following items: 3. An instruction sheet for the
driver describing ELD malfunction reporting requirements and
record keeping procedures during ELD malfunctions. The
following instructions are in accordance with the guidelines set
forth in  395.34:

How does the driver know if the ELD is malfunctioning?
Neither of the LED lights on the device are turned on (neither
green nor red) when the device is plugged into the trucks
diagnostic port and power is owing to it.
